本文详细介绍了unlink攻击技术的核心原理,虽然上述介绍的unlink漏洞利用技术已经失效,但是还是有必要认真学习,因为它一方面可以进一步加深我们对glibc malloc的堆栈管理机制的理解,另一方面也为后续的各种堆溢出攻击技术提供思路。 ...
分类:
系统相关 时间:
2016-06-06 15:04:09
阅读次数:
229
今天给/etc创建了个链接,删除软链接,导致删掉后,/etc/下文件全没了. 于是搜集了这篇文章. 1、创建一个软连接 2、删除软连接出现错误 3、删除软连接的正确方式 4、只是删除了软连接文件(正确方式) 5、错误操作,通过软连接删除了实际存在的数据。 备注:想要删除链接文件要用以下命令 rm / ...
分类:
系统相关 时间:
2016-06-05 23:12:50
阅读次数:
309
在你准备升级GLIBC库之前,你要好好思考一下,你真的要升级GLIBC么?你知道你自己在做什么么?http://baike.baidu.com/view/1323132.htm?fr=aladdinglibc是gnu发布的libc库,即c运行库。glibc是linux系统中最底层的api,几乎其它任何运行库都会依赖于glibc。glibc除了封装linux..
分类:
系统相关 时间:
2016-06-02 20:21:17
阅读次数:
689
最近在给编译环境centOS6.5安装新版clang(clang3.4/3.5)的时候,虽然已经装了gcc4.9.1,但编译的时候(参考clang官方主页http://clang.llvm.org/get_started.html的步骤,在独立build目录下运行clang自带的configure脚本),仍然出了“ccompiler
cannotcreateexecutables”的提..
分类:
系统相关 时间:
2016-06-02 20:19:14
阅读次数:
217
sql2000数据库误删除后自行恢复二次覆盖成功恢复【数据恢复故障描述】今天接到一个客户电话,他的速达sql2000数据库,数据库误删除了,关键之前还没有备份过。他就想自己尝试恢复,使用网上下载的恢复工具恢复出一些数据之后,本来数据库在E盘,结果他又将恢复的数据保存在了E..
分类:
数据库 时间:
2016-05-28 23:33:21
阅读次数:
458
[root@localhost ~]# rpm -qa |grep glibcglibc-common-2.12-1.132.el6.x86_64glibc-devel-2.12-1.132.el6.x86_64glibc-2.12-1.132.el6.x86_64glibc-headers-2.1... ...
分类:
其他好文 时间:
2016-05-26 10:24:12
阅读次数:
1009
一、问题现象当不小心删除了Exchange2010中的"组织配置"——>“地址列表”——“所有会议室”地址列表时,是无法通过图形界面进行恢复的,需要通过命令来重建。表现出来的错误现象是:1、在系统日志中的应用程序日志中出现“MSExchangeADAccessEventID2937描述为..
分类:
其他好文 时间:
2016-05-25 19:03:24
阅读次数:
564
前言:mariadb官方网站上提供了三种不同形式的程序包:源码包版、程序包管理器版、和二进制版,如下图所示。二进制版是由官方编译好的绿色版,相比源码包版安装更简单,比起程序包管理器版又多一点自由度,算是二者的折中方案。另外要注意它依赖于glibc,需要注意glibc的版本。..
分类:
数据库 时间:
2016-05-25 18:54:23
阅读次数:
648
ERP软件数据库覆盖数据恢复成功/重装数据库系统软件,导致同名文件覆盖【数据恢复故障描述】上海某酒店ERP软件原来安装在C盘上,用户误操作把软件进行了卸载,发现软件没有了,但操作之前没有把原来的数据库文件复制出来,没有备份,重装好后,又把新的同名数据库安装到原来的..
分类:
数据库 时间:
2016-05-24 17:15:28
阅读次数:
189
在基于 GNU glibc 的系统上,包括所有 linux 系统,ELF 可执行二进制文件的运行自动导致程序加载器被加载并且运行。 在 linux 下,加载器是 /lib/ld-linux.so.X(X是版本号)。然后加载器搜索、加载程序所要使用的动态链接库。被搜索的文件夹列表保存在文件 /etc/ ...
分类:
其他好文 时间:
2016-05-23 17:05:59
阅读次数:
170